Use 1-inch screws or nails to secure the vent. Web12 mrt. 2015 · Smooth, rigid ducts with tape or mastic around all joints will prevent air leakage. Always insulate the duct to prevent condensation problems as the warm air will be potentially running through cold ductwork. Foam tubing or fiberglass will work, but it’s also possible to buy pre-insulated 4”duct. At the roof itself, use high quality vents ...

Web7 sep. 2024 · The dryer vent can be run through the attic, but it can’t be terminated there. If you filled your attic with warm, moist air that could rot the framing and ruin the insulation, lint from the dryer could cause other problems. WebYou transition to 4" hardline at the Dryerbox and sent it up the wall as an oval not a circle. (On a 2x6 wall it stays round) Once the oval passes the top plate the round duct goes back to round if you give it a foot or so of run. You want it round before you do a 90 if necessary and they sell a swept 90 that negates the five foot penalty. WebA powered attic ventilator, or attic fan, is a ventilation fan which regulates the heat level of a building's attic by exhausting hot air. A thermostat is used to automatically turn the fan off and on, while sometimes a manual switch is used. An attic fan can be gable mounted or roof mounted. Additional vents are required to draw in the fresh air as the hot air is …

Insulate the vent 5. … how early to arrive to cbxWeb12 okt. 2024 · Whether you should insulate your dryer vent or not depends on its location. If the dryer duct is within the home or a heated basement, there is no need or reason to insulate the duct/vent pipe. However, if the dryer duct runs through an unheated basement or crawlspace—insulation is highly recommended.
